Voice/Video Conferencing for At-Home Workers
A wide selection of voice/video conferencing products from leading vendors enable online meetings, video conferencing, chat, and screen/content sharing for both local workers and at-home workers. Many companies use a mix of products to meet the needs of their various partners and customers. - Skype for Business is Microsoft's leading unified communications platform that supports presence, IM, audio and video calling and conferencing plus the transparent integration of these functions within Office desktop and Microsoft 365 productivity software such as PowerPoint, Word, Excel and Outlook. - FaceTime is Apple's multiuser video calling platform for iOS, iPadOS, iPod and macOS devices. FaceTime runs on Wi-Fi or cellular Internet connections. Later editions of FaceTime support as many as 32 concurrent users for voice/video sessions. - Webex Meeting Center supports remote conferencing for most desktop or mobile devices. Delivered via Cisco's Webex Cloud, Webex services include sharing discrete content or screens, presentations that incorporate rich media including Microsoft PowerPoint and Flash videos, network-based capture, plus editing and playback for future reference. - Teams is Microsoft's next-generation replacement for Skype for Business. Teams provides a portal for conversations, contacts, and content with features that include video conferencing, persistent threaded chat, plus data sharing.
